Cross-site Scripting in invenio-previewer

Moderate severity GitHub Reviewed Published Jul 15, 2019 in inveniosoftware/invenio-previewer • Updated Jan 9, 2023

Package

pip invenio-previewer (pip)

Affected versions

<= 1.0.0a11

Patched versions

1.0.0a12

Description

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ability in JSON, Markdown and iPython Notebook previewers

Impact

Several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ities have been found in the JSON, Markdown and iPython Notebook previewers. The vulnerabilities would allow a malicous user to upload a JSON, Markdown or Notebook file with embedded scripts that would be executed by a victims browser.

Patches

Invenio-Previewer v1.0.0a12 fixes the issue.

Workarounds

You can remediate the vulnerability without upgrading by disabling the affected previewers. You do this by adding the following to your configuration:

PREVIEWER_PREFERENCE = [
    'csv_dthreejs',
    'simple_image',
    # 'json_prismjs',
    'xml_prismjs',
    # 'mistune',
    'pdfjs',
    # 'ipynb',
    'zip',
]

Afterwards, you should not be able to preview JSON, Markdown or iPython Notebook files.

CVSS v3 base metrics

Attack vector: More severe the more the remote (logically and physically) an attacker can be in order to exploit the vulnerability.
Attack complexity: More severe for the least complex attacks.
Privileges required: More severe if no privileges are required.
User interaction: More severe when no user interaction is required.
Scope: More severe when a scope change occurs, e.g. one vulnerable component impacts resources in components beyond its security scope.
Confidentiality: More severe when loss of data confidentiality is highest, measuring the level of data access available to an unauthorized user.
Integrity: More severe when loss of data integrity is the highest, measuring the consequence of data modification possible by an unauthorized user.
Availability: More severe when the loss of impacted component availability is highest.
